Turbine Vent Repair in Provo, UT
Turbine vent repair services focus on maintaining and restoring the functionality of ventilator turbines commonly installed on rooftops. These vents are essential for allowing proper airflow and ventilation within a property, helping to prevent moisture buildup, reduce heat accumulation, and improve overall indoor air quality. Projects may involve fixing or replacing damaged blades, addressing leaks, or restoring the integrity of the vent housing to ensure it operates efficiently and safely.
Homeowners and property owners often seek turbine vent repairs when they notice issues such as unusual noises, leaks around the vent, or decreased ventilation performance. It’s important to understand the condition of the existing vent system and whether any damage or wear has compromised its effectiveness. Proper assessment can help determine if repairs are sufficient or if a full replacement is necessary to maintain optimal attic ventilation and protect the property’s structure.

Turbine Vent Repair Questions
What causes turbine vent issues? Common causes include debris buildup, damaged blades, or worn bearings that affect proper ventilation.
How can I tell if my turbine vent needs repair? Signs include excessive noise, leaks, or noticeable wobbling during strong winds.
Is turbine vent repair necessary for energy efficiency? Yes, properly functioning vents help improve attic ventilation and can enhance overall energy efficiency.
What types of repairs are typically performed on turbine vents? Repairs often involve replacing damaged blades, fixing leaks, or securing loose components to restore proper function.
